A records, a problem that keeps buging me.

5stars

Active Member
Oct 10, 2006
38
0
156
I have recently registered 2 nameservers with my domain registar.
All works fine exept that the name servers are not suplying A records.
Is this normal?
Should the registered name servers provide A records? or is it something on my side that needs to be done.


I added A entrys for my name servers(NS1 and NS2) from the WHM basic server configuration but I still have the same problem.
Also there is an A record on the domain added in the dns zone.

This is the whole zone
$ttl 38400
crdserver.net. IN SOA server.crdserver.net. root.localhost. (
1172785335
10800
3600
604800
38400 )
crdserver.net. IN NS server.crdserver.net.
crdserver.net. IN A 89.34.116.11
www.crdserver.net. IN CNAME crdserver.net
mail.crdserver.net. IN CNAME crdserver.net
ftp.crdserver.net. IN CNAME crdserver.net
crdserver.net. IN MX 10 crdserver.net.



This is what I get under dnsstuff.com:
89.34.116.11 PTR record: crdserver.net. [TTL 38400s] [A=None] *ERROR* There is no A record for crdserver.net. (may be negatively cached).

I also have access to my DNS zones for my IP, my isp granted my access so I can make modifications to my ptr address and to other dns zones.

Wha can I do about this?
 

5stars

Active Member
Oct 10, 2006
38
0
156
Make sure the DNS zone for crdserver.net also says:
Code:
NS1     "A"        89.34.112.12
NS2     "A"        89.34.116.11

It seems I can't add the root dns zone from WHM because I have no way of revesing it after that if added from WHM.
My ISP allowed me to make modifications to the reverse zone so I can set up my ptr record, if I create a zone from WHM it will not bind with the reverse zone, so I have to create them from webmin, and here is the problem.
When creating the master zone forward and reverse from webmin I ran in to some problems, the zone will not stand and it will get erased after I add let's say a zone for any domain from WHM the master zone will get erased for some reason, I'm in a total dilema.

When creating the dns zone from WHM for crdsrv.net it will create a zone with the file
.crdserver.net.db";
in name.conf it will apear as
zone "server.crdserver.net" {
type master;
file "/var/named/server.crdserver.net.db";
};
-----------------------------------------------------------------
The above tipe of file won't work with a reverse zone file : 89.34.116.rev
The reverse zone is described in the named.config as.
zone "116.34.89.in-addr.arpa" {
type master;
file "/var/named/89.34.116.rev";
allow-update { none; };
};


When creating it from webmin it works just fine, it generates something like this.
zone "crdserver.net" {
type master;
file "/var/named/crdserver.net.hosts";
allow-update { none; };
};
In stead of how WHM creates it with :"crdserver.net.db";

and the reverse address seems to work like this.

The only problem is when I add another dns entry from WHM the entrys in named.conf get erased.
This are the entrys that get erased after adding another zone from WHM

Entry for the master forward zone
zone "crdserver.net" {
type master;
file "/var/named/crdserver.net.hosts";
allow-update { none; };
};


And entry for the Reverse zone.
zone "116.34.89.in-addr.arpa" {
type master;
file "/var/named/89.34.116.rev";
allow-update { none; };
};

I'm totaly in a puzzle as WHM makes it imposible for me to add reverse entrys in any way.
 
Last edited:

5stars

Active Member
Oct 10, 2006
38
0
156
Fixed the erasing problem, but still no A record for my ptr record.
Here is my improved crdsrv.net zone.

; cPanel 10.9.0-BETA_137
; Zone file for crdserver.net
$TTL 14400
@ 86400 IN SOA ns1.crdserver.net. cretudaniels417.hotmail.com. ( 2007030413 ; serial, todays date+todays
86400 ; refresh, seconds
7200 ; retry, seconds
3600000 ; expire, seconds
86400 ) ; minimum, seconds

crdserver.net. 86400 IN NS ns1.crdserver.net.
crdserver.net. 86400 IN NS ns2.crdserver.net.

ns2.crdserver.net. IN A 89.34.116.11
ns1.crdserver.net. IN A 89.34.112.12

crdserver.net. IN A 89.34.116.11

localhost.crdserver.net. IN A 127.0.0.1

crdserver.net. IN MX 0 crdserver.net.

mail IN CNAME crdserver.net.
www IN CNAME crdserver.net.
ftp IN CNAME crdserver.net.
server 14400 IN A 89.34.116.11
ns1 14400 IN A 89.34.112.12
ns2 14400 IN A 89.34.116.11



What I did is recostruct the dns entry for the main domain on the server.
It was scrabled and the A entry for the server name and the nameserver entrys use to be separate, they all use to be as a separate file zones, what I did, I deleted the nameserver entrys and the A entry, I then created the primary zone for the main domain"crdserver.net" and a reverse address, after that, I added an A entry for the host name which added it self on the main domain zone, the same hapend with the Nameservers, they added them selfs to the main domain zone, but......still no A record for my ptr:(
Dnsstuff reports.
89.34.116.11 PTR record: crdserver.net. [TTL 38400s] [A=None] *ERROR* There is no A record for crdserver.net. (may be negatively cached).

What else can it be from?